On Thursday a Deputy Police Chief, Keith Foster, 51, was arrested on drug charges. Arrested in Fresno, CA, the charges included possession and the intent to distribute heroin, oxycodone, and marijuana.
The FBI and the federal Bureau of Alcohol, Tobacco, Firearms and Explosives charged Foster along with four other people. Foster is now on paid administration leave.
With stories like this more and more we must ask the questions of who polices the Police.
With stories like this more and more we must ask the questions of who polices the Police.
Written By: Lauren Beal I @laurenbeal